Mary D. Gialdini, 81 of Carmel, passed away Wednesday, September 23, 2015. Mary was born August 20, 1934 in Chicago to the late Anthony and Angeline Raimondi. On May 23, 1953 she married James Gialdini, they were happily married for 58 years. Mary retired from Carmel High School where she was employed as a secretary for 25 years. She had a career as a secretary working at the Jewish Community Center in Creve Coeur, MO, Marsha Bagby Elementary School in Shawnee Mission, KS and Glenbard East High School in Elmhurst, IL.
Mary was a member of St. Elizabeth Ann Seton Catholic Church and its Women's Club and several bridge groups. She served as President of the Carmel Women's Club, President of the Carmel Clay Education Support Services Association and was Queen Mother of the Red Hat Mama's of the Red Hat Society.
Mary was the widow of James Gialdini. She is survived by her children, Michael (Tom Schmitt) Gialdini and Michele (Kevin) Matson; grandchildren, Nicholas Matson and Domenica Matson; great grandchildren, Finnigan and Madelyn Whitaker; sister, Roseann Perry.
